Real Value
The value of an object, service, or currency adjusted for inflation, representing its purchasing power.
Nominal Dollars
Nominal dollars refer to the amount of money expressed in current values, without adjustment for inflation, representing the "face value" of currency.
Fixed Incomes
Fixed incomes refer to types of investment that pay regular interest or dividends to investors and have the principal amount returned at maturity.
Nominal Interest Rate
The interest rate before adjustments for inflation, representing the face value of borrowing costs or investment returns.
